Step1: Define Propositions
Let \( p \) be "a polygon has exactly three sides" and \( q \) be "it is a triangle".
Step2: Analyze the Argument Structure
- The first statement is a conditional: \( p
ightarrow q \) (If \( p \), then \( q \)).
- The second statement is \( p \) (Jeri drew a polygon with exactly three sides, so \( p \) is true).
- The conclusion is \( q \) (Therefore, Jeri drew a triangle, so \( q \) follows).
- This matches the structure \( p
ightarrow q \), \( p \), \( \therefore q \), which is option D.
